1. 起動
「システム環境設定」 > 「共有」
「Web共有」にチェックを入れる
2. アクセス
http://localhost/
http://localhost/~ユーザー名
3. ドキュメントルート
/Library/WebServer/Documents
/Users/ユーザー名/Sites
4. CGI
ディレクトリ
/Library/WebServer/CGI-Executables
アクセス
http://localhost/cgi-bin/xxx.cgi
※ユーザーはデフォルトではCGIが動かない
設定ファイルを変更する必要がある
※Options に ExecCGI を追加
AddHandler cgi-script .cgi
5. 設定
/private/etc/apache2/httpd.conf
/private/etc/apache2/users/ユーザー名.conf
6. cgiのパーミッション
$ chmod 755 hoge.cgi
7. ログ
/private/var/log/apache2/error_log
2010年2月12日金曜日
2010年2月8日月曜日
2010年2月4日木曜日
[Linux] SSHでプロキシ経由でアクセス
会社や学校など、直接インターネットにアクセスできない環境で、SSHを使って外部サーバーにアクセスしたい。
1. ~/.ssh/config を編集
Host hoge.example.com
HostName hoge.example.com
ProxyCommand /usr/bin/nc -X 5 -x socks.poge.com:1080 %h %p
Compression yes
ServerAliveInterval 15
-X 4: SOCKS v.4
-X 5: SOCKS v.5
-X connect: HTTPS proxy
※nc(netcat)の他にconnectでもいい
※http://www.unixuser.org/~euske/doc/openssh/jman/ssh_config.html
2. # chmod 600 ~/.ssh/config
1. ~/.ssh/config を編集
Host hoge.example.com
HostName hoge.example.com
ProxyCommand /usr/bin/nc -X 5 -x socks.poge.com:1080 %h %p
Compression yes
ServerAliveInterval 15
-X 4: SOCKS v.4
-X 5: SOCKS v.5
-X connect: HTTPS proxy
※nc(netcat)の他にconnectでもいい
※http://www.unixuser.org/~euske/doc/openssh/jman/ssh_config.html
2. # chmod 600 ~/.ssh/config
[Wikipedia] WikipediaのデータをMySQLに読み込む
□リンク
−Data dumps 詳細
http://meta.wikimedia.org/wiki/Data_dumps
−データダウンロード
http://download.wikimedia.org/
例えば、下記をダウンロード
jawiki-2010xxxx-pages-articles.xml.bz2
jawiki-2010xxxx-category.sql.gz
jawiki-2010xxxx-categorylinks.sql.gz
□MediaWikiを使ってMySQLに読み込む
−MediaWiki
http://www.mediawiki.org/wiki/Manual:importing_XML_dumps
−MySQLの設定
/etc/my.cnf を編集
max_allowed_packet = 32M
−MySQLの再起動
/etc/rc.d/init.d/mysqld stop
/etc/rc.d/init.d/mysqld start
−MySQLの設定の確認
mysql> show variables like 'max_allowed_packet';
−データベースとテーブルの作成
mysql> ceate database wikipedia;
mysql> use wikipedia
mysql> source mediawiki-1.15.1/maintenance/tables.sql;
※tables.sql はmediawikiに含まれる
mediawiki-1.15.1/maintenace/tables.sql
−データのインポート
$ gunzip jawiki-2010xxxx-category.sql.gz
$ gunzip jawiki-2010xxxx-categorylinks.sql.gz
$ mysql -u root -p wikipedia < jawiki-20090707-category.sql
$ mysql -u root -p wikipedia < jawiki-20090707-categorylinks.sql
$ java -jar mwdumper.jar --format=sql:1.5 jawiki-2010xxxx-pages-articles.xml.bz2 | mysql -u login_name -p wikipedia
−Data dumps 詳細
http://meta.wikimedia.org/wiki/Data_dumps
−データダウンロード
http://download.wikimedia.org/
例えば、下記をダウンロード
jawiki-2010xxxx-pages-articles.xml.bz2
jawiki-2010xxxx-category.sql.gz
jawiki-2010xxxx-categorylinks.sql.gz
□MediaWikiを使ってMySQLに読み込む
−MediaWiki
http://www.mediawiki.org/wiki/Manual:importing_XML_dumps
−MySQLの設定
/etc/my.cnf を編集
max_allowed_packet = 32M
−MySQLの再起動
/etc/rc.d/init.d/mysqld stop
/etc/rc.d/init.d/mysqld start
−MySQLの設定の確認
mysql> show variables like 'max_allowed_packet';
−データベースとテーブルの作成
mysql> ceate database wikipedia;
mysql> use wikipedia
mysql> source mediawiki-1.15.1/maintenance/tables.sql;
※tables.sql はmediawikiに含まれる
mediawiki-1.15.1/maintenace/tables.sql
−データのインポート
$ gunzip jawiki-2010xxxx-category.sql.gz
$ gunzip jawiki-2010xxxx-categorylinks.sql.gz
$ mysql -u root -p wikipedia < jawiki-20090707-category.sql
$ mysql -u root -p wikipedia < jawiki-20090707-categorylinks.sql
$ java -jar mwdumper.jar --format=sql:1.5 jawiki-2010xxxx-pages-articles.xml.bz2 | mysql -u login_name -p wikipedia
登録:
投稿 (Atom)